Rice pudding

Posted on April 15, 2013 by Ana López MontesApril 15, 2013avatar

There are many typical Turkish desserts that are very similar to those we have in Spain, but always with some variation. For example sutlac is something like our rice pudding. Basic ingredients and a very easy dessert … Continue reading →
